ABSTRACT

Background: Timely bystander cardiopulmonary resuscitation is the key to improving the survival rate of out-of-hospital cardiac arrest. Civil servants are potential bystander CPR providers. This study aimed to explore civil servants' willingness to implement CPR in Chongqing, identify the influencing factors and mechanisms affecting civil servants' willingness to perform CPR, and then seek countermeasures to improve civil servants' willingness to implement CPR. Methods: We introduced the theory of perceived risk into the theory of planned behavior, developed a 7-point Likert scale based on the extended theory of planned behavior, and conducted a questionnaire survey on civil servants in Chongqing, China. Descriptive statistical analysis and one-way ANOVA were employed to explore respondents' willingness and differences. Structural equation modeling was used to analyze the relationship between attitude, subjective norm, perceived behavioral control and perceived risk and respondents' willingness to implement CPR. Results: A total of 1235 valid questionnaires were included for analysis. 50.1 % of respondents were willing to implement CPR. Male, over 40 years old, living with the elderly, having previous experience performing CPR on another person, and having higher CPR knowledge scores were associated with a more positive willingness to perform CPR. Attitude, subjective norm and perceived behavioral control had significant positive effects on willingness, and the standardized regression coefficients were 0.164, 0.326 and 0.313, respectively. The perceived risk has a significant negative effect on willingness, and the standardized regression coefficient was -0.109. The four latent variables accounted for 44.2 % of the variance in the willingness of civil servants to implement CPR. Conclusions: The willingness of civil servants in Chongqing to implement CPR needs to be improved, and the countermeasures to enhance the subjective norm and perceived behavioral control of civil servants should be emphasized, such as developing a social support network for rescuing conduct, establishing regular training mechanisms and improving the practical applicability and popularization of the Chinese-style "Good Samaritan Law" etc., to improve the willingness of civil servants in Chongqing to implement CPR.

ABSTRACT

Carbamazepine (CBZ) is a widely used anticonvulsant drug that has been detected in aquatic environments. This study investigated the toxicity of its by-products (CBZ-BPs), which may surpass CBZ. Unlike the previous studies, this study offered a more systematic approach to identifying toxic BPs and inferring degradation pathways. Furthermore, quadrupole time-of-flight (QTOF) and density functional theory (DFT) calculations were employed to analyze CBZ-BP structures and degradation pathways. Evaluation of total organic carbon (TOC) and total nitrogen (TN) mineralization rates, revealed carbon (C) greater susceptibility to mineralization compared with nitrogen (N). Furthermore, three rules were established for CBZ decarbonization and N removal during degradation, observing the transformation of aromatic compounds into aliphatic hydrocarbons and stable N-containing organic matter over time. Five potentially highly toxic BPs were screened from 14 identified BPs, with toxicity predictions guiding the selection of commercial standards for quantification and true toxicity testing. Additionally, BP207 emerged as the most toxic, supported by the predictive toxicity accumulation model (PTAM). Notably, highly toxic BPs feature an acridine structure, indicating its significant contribution to toxicity. These findings offered valuable insights into the degradation mechanisms of emerging contaminants and the biosafety of aquatic environments during deep oxidation.

ABSTRACT

BACKGROUND: Chongqing, the most populous city in Southwest China. This study aims to examine the equity of health resource allocation in Chongqing using the latest statistics, analyse possible shortcomings and propose strategies to address these issues. METHODS: This cross-sectional study used healthcare resource, population, area and gross domestic product data from the Seventh National Census Bulletin of Chongqing, the National County Statistical Yearbook, the Chongqing Municipal Bureau of Statistics and the Chongqing Health Statistical Yearbook 2022. We also studied the equity of health resource allocation in Chongqing by using the Gini coefficient, Lorenz curve and Theil index, and used the Analytical Hierarchy Process and Technique for Order of Preference by Similarity to Ideal Solution (AHP-TOPSIS) method to comprehensively evaluate the health resources in the four major regions of Chongqing. RESULTS: The Gini coefficient of health resources in Chongqing in 2021 was the highest when allocated according to geographical area, between 0.4285 and 0.6081, both of which exceeded 0.4, and the Gini coefficient of medical equipment was the highest and exceeded 0.6. The inter-regional Theil index of each resource was greater than the intraregional Theil index, and the contribution of inter-regional differences ranged from 64.83% to 80.21%. The results of the AHP-TOPSIS method showed that the relative proximity between health resources and ideal solutions in four regions of Chongqing ranged from 0.0753 to 0.9277. CONCLUSION: The allocation of health resources in Chongqing exhibits pronounced inequities, particularly in the distribution of medical equipment according to geographical area. Moreover, there exists a substantial gap in the equity of health resource allocation among the four regions of Chongqing. As such, this study emphasises the need for Chongqing, China, to prioritise the equitable allocation of health resources and increase consideration of geographic factors. Implementing measures to promote equitable allocation of health resources, particularly in geographic terms, is critical.
